Transaction 64b116b66d28d3be332aff47ef161af4be9009f4ea222032025cb5b68db60376
1 Input
2 Outputs
- 64b116b66d28d3be332aff47ef161af4be9009f4ea222032025cb5b68db60376:0
- 64b116b66d28d3be332aff47ef161af4be9009f4ea222032025cb5b68db60376:1
value 21148014
address 3NYCsy67xj3VB7aT3fc5LM8JRYsterCZ6r
value 38671624
address 1J4ir8KdamHSsP39xNmNtdyDs1j5XiJBYv